Welcome to Perimenopausal Conversations for Busy Women, where we help busy women navigate perimenopause, hormone balance, and everyday stress using essential oils and practical holistic tools. In this episode, Meg and Heather discuss and define brain fog. It is a combination of estrogen dropping, not sleeping well, stress stealing our working memory, and the mental load of keeping up with it all. Meg offers 3 practical steps - bedtime routine, moving our bodies, and nutrition. Heather also stresses the importance of having systems in place that work for you. Does it feel like your brain has become mush ever since becoming a mom? In this episode, Whitney connects with neuroscientist and therapist Dr. Jodi Pawluski to unpack the truth about "mommy brain" and what's actually happening in the brain during pregnancy and postpartum. Despite what we've all joked about, your brain isn't actually turning to mush; it's changing in really intentional ways to help you care for your child.   Together, they break down the science behind mom brain, why so many women experience brain fog, forgetfulness, and overwhelm, and how mental load and modern motherhood can make it all feel even heavier. Memory loss does not mean soul loss in this deeply unforgettable episode of White Shores where Theresa talks to Prof Stephen G Post one of the world's leading scholars on altruism, love, compassion, and the science of giving. He is a best-selling author, professor of preventive medicine, and founder of the Institute for Research on Pure Unlimited Love. Post is widely considered the premier American bioethicist and scholar on the relationship between altruism, compassion and well-being in both the recipient and giver. His pioneering book The Moral Challenge of Alzheimer Disease was recognised as a medical classic of the 20th century by the British Medical Journal. Ever wonder why your kid can recite every line from their favorite YouTube video but somehow “forgets” their shoes, homework, and to throw away the empty cereal box… all in the same morning? Before you pull your hair out, take a breath—this might not be laziness at all.  In this episode, Dr. Tori Cordiano, a licensed clinical psychologist and Co-Director of Laurel's Center for Research on Girls in Shaker Heights helps us decode executive functioning: what it is, why your kid struggles with it (spoiler: their brain's still under construction), and how you can stop expecting skills they literally don't have yet.  You'll laugh, you'll sigh in relief, and you'll finally get why socks end up everywhere. Kelsie Watts's musical journey began in Lubbock, Texas, where she found her voice at two years old in a family of musicians. From early performances in church and school to studying opera and commercial music at Belmont University in Nashville, she developed her craft and gained recognition. Her self-released music led to a feature on AJ McLean's 2020 single “Hurts to Love You,” while her viral rendition of Kelly Clarkson's “I Dare You” on The Voice Season 19 earned her a spot on Team Kelly and millions of views. Now an independent pop artist, Kelsie continues to inspire with her music and advocacy. Her single “Live Out Loud” became the anthem for the Tokyo Sky Tree Global Campaign during the 2021 Olympics, followed by empowering tracks like “Look What You Missed” and the poignant ballad “I Can't Say Goodbye,” honoring her late brother who she lost to mental health struggles. In 2024, she released “After Midnight” and “Forgetful,” a Diane Warren-penned duet with Nate Amor. Beyond music, Kelsie is a dedicated mental health advocate, collaborating with organizations like Didi Hirsch and the Not Alone Challenge. Kelsie stars on Broadway in the musical, SIX.
